A success timeline featuring the most significant achievements of Tucker Carlson.
Tucker Carlson is an American conservative political commentator known for hosting Tucker Carlson Tonight on Fox News (2016-2023). Following his departure from Fox News, he started shows on X and his own platform. He is a prominent figure in right-wing media, often associated with Trumpism and known for expressing views related to white grievance politics. He is also described as a conspiracy theorist.
In September 2003, Tucker Carlson's memoir Politicians, Partisans, and Parasites: My Adventures in Cable News was published by Warner Books. The book received favorable reviews.
In 2003, Tucker Carlson's Esquire profile on his journey to Liberia alongside Reverend Al Sharpton garnered a nomination at the National Magazine Awards.
On November 14, 2016, Tucker Carlson began hosting Tucker Carlson Tonight on Fox News, which became the network's most-watched telecast of the year in its time slot.
In January 2017, Forbes reported that Tucker Carlson Tonight had consistently high ratings, averaging 2.8 million viewers per night.
In March 2017, Tucker Carlson Tonight was the most watched cable program in the 9:00 p.m. time slot.
As of March 2018, Tucker Carlson Tonight was the third-highest-rated cable news show.
In October 2018, Tucker Carlson Tonight was the second-highest rated cable news show in prime time, with 3.2 million nightly viewers.
In October 2018, Tucker Carlson released Ship of Fools: How a Selfish Ruling Class is Bringing America to the Brink of Revolution. It debuted at No. 1 on The New York Times Best Seller list.
By October 2020, Tucker Carlson Tonight averaged 5.3 million viewers, becoming the highest of any cable news program in history at that point.
Beginning the week of June 8–14, 2020, Tucker Carlson Tonight became the highest-rated cable news show in the U.S., with an average of four million viewers.
In 2021, Time magazine described Tucker Carlson as "may be the most powerful conservative in America", reflecting his influence in American politics.
In 2021, Tucker Carlson Tonight remained the most-watched news-related cable show.
By July 2024, The Tucker Carlson Show became the #1 most popular podcast on Spotify, signaling a resurgence in Carlson's popularity.
